Priority: High for next release

The batch email digest scheduler on Driftmere has drifted between staging and production. Staging runs digests hourly while production reverted to the old six-hour window after the failover two weeks ago, so release validation no longer reflects prod behavior. This affects sign-off for the upcoming cut. Recommend freezing scheduler changes until both environments are aligned and the drift source is identified. For comparison, production is currently running with these values.

deployment values, taweg-bajop:
[fenvan]
port = 5672
team = holmir
host = fenvan.orvexio.example
region = lower-1
access_code = ac_b98bc6
timeout_ms = 1500

CI note: Hedgerow stale-branch bot deleting protected branches

The Hedgerow cleanup bot was removing release-freeze branches because the protection glob only matched lowercase prefixes. Pattern is now case-insensitive and the bot dry-runs for 48 hours after any config change. If branches vanish again, check the dry-run log first. Fix confirmed on the run tagged below.

trace token, kahog-tajeg: htk6_97d963

CI note — occupancy feed ingest (Garrow Parking / LotPulse). The nightly build fails at the fixture stage because the occupancy feed replay for the Marwick Deck dataset now emits stall counts as floats. Parser in lotpulse-ingest still expects ints, so the schema check trips and the whole pipeline reds out. Patch coerces floats with a tolerance of 0.01 and updates the golden fixtures. Ran the replay twice locally, both green. Reviewer: check the coercion logic, not the fixtures. Token for the passing run follows.

build token for haduf-bafog: htk21_2d98ce91a83676b65394a

## Releases

Quick note for the sync: the nightly search reindex on Mossgate now ships as its own release artifact instead of piggybacking on the API deploy. It runs at 01:30, takes ~20 minutes, and rolls back automatically on checksum mismatch. Artifacts must be signed before the runner will touch them. The key we sign reindex artifacts with is below.

release key, bagep-yajof: bky19_xtqFhCW5hRYj5CXT2ZJ